Please Note
Hydrogen Peroxide will vent in transit, especially in warm weather. All of our bottles have a venting lid on to prevent bottles distending.
They are also slightly over filled to allow for any loss due to venting.
Venting may present as moisture on bottles inside the transport bag, this is not "leaking".
What is Hydrogen Peroxide 3% Food Grade? Hydrogen Peroxide (H2O2) is a versatile and powerful oxidiser, widely used in both industrial and laboratory applications. It is commonly employed as a disinfectant, antiseptic, and bleach, breaking down into water and oxygen when decomposed.

Frequent Uses
Chemical Reactions and Synthesis
The oxidising ability of Hydrogen Peroxide is so strong that it is considered a highly reactive oxygen species. Hydrogen Peroxide is therefore used as a propellant in rocketry.
Cleaning and Decontamination
Hydrogen Peroxide can be used to remove organic residues from glassware and instruments. Due to its oxidative properties, it helps break down proteins, lipids, and other organic materials.
Disinfection
Hydrogen Peroxide is commonly used for disinfecting lab glassware, work surfaces, and biological safety cabinets. It eff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ores, making it ideal for keeping a sterile environment.
Immunohistochemistry (IHC)
Hydrogen Peroxide is used in tissue processing and preparation, Hydrogen Peroxide can bleach tissue sections or reduce background staining in histological samples.
Safety Applications
In emergency situations, Hydrogen Peroxide can neutralise certain chemical spills by breaking down hazardous compounds into less harmful substances.

Contains:
Hydrogen Peroxide 35% Food Grade: <3% w/v
Distilled Water: <97% w/v
Cas Number: 7722-84-1
Einecs Number: 231-765-0
HS Code / Commodity Code: 2847000000
Hazard Phrases: H319
Prec Phrases: P264,P280,P305+P351+P338,P337+P313
